There are 1 owner-reported lighting complaints for the 2017 Mercedes-Benz S-Classin NHTSA's database. These are unverified consumer reports and may not reflect confirmed defects.
This car since new has had moisture in the headlight from rain or washing. MB has installed moisture packets in the headlights that they said would fix the problem. It never did. I called the dealership and complained, they said sorry but that was their fix (MB TSB LI82.10-P-062051). Now the lights have failed, and they want me to spend $10K to replace the headlights and continue with the same issue. The problem still exists with the new headlights. This is not only a poor way to fix an ongoing problem (Moisture packets) for something that is severely related to safety on the highways in America. I believe you will agree. Please respond?
